Taxonomy & naming
Crenicichla yjhui was described in 2019 by Lubomír Piálek, Jorge Casciotta, Adriana Almirón and Oldřich Říčan, in the journal Hydrobiologia (vol. 832: 377–395), in a paper titled 'A new pelagic predatory pike cichlid… with parallel and reticulate evolution.' The holotype (MLP 11187, in the Museo de La Plata, 5 in standard length) was taken from the Embalse Urugua-í — the Urugua-í reservoir — at the camping ground, in the río Paraná basin of Misiones Province, Argentina (about 25°52′S, 54°33′W), with paratypes lodged at the MLP and the Museo Argentino de Ciencias Naturales (MACN). Crenicichla is the largest and most widely distributed genus of Neotropical cichlids — well over a hundred valid 'pike cichlids' — and yjhui sits in the lacustris species group, specifically within the Crenicichla mandelburgeri species complex, a cluster of closely related, largely sympatric pikes endemic to the middle Paraná and its tributaries that has become a textbook case of rapid, river-confined adaptive radiation. The work behind the species is the product of a decade of phylogenetic study by Piálek, Říčan, Casciotta, Almirón and Edward Burress. Their analyses gave yjhui an unusually tangled origin: mitochondrial DNA places it nested within the widespread Crenicichla mandelburgeri, while reduced-representation (ddRAD) genomic data show it to be of hybrid (reticulate) origin, sharing ancestry with Crenicichla ypo, one of the two related pikes alongside which it lives. A major 2023 revision of the pike cichlids by Marcelo Varella, Sven Kullander and collaborators split the old, sprawling Crenicichla into several genera (Wallaciia, Saxatilia, Hemeraia, Lugubria), but the lacustris-group species — including the whole mandelburgeri complex and yjhui with it — were retained in Crenicichla in the strict sense, so the name is unaffected by that reshuffle.
Morphology
Crenicichla yjhui has the classic elongate, cylindrical pike-cichlid build, with the dorsal and anal fins set far back and a bluntly pointed snout, the streamlined outline of a fish built to chase rather than to lie in wait. It is a medium-sized pike: the type series reached about 5 in standard length (roughly 5 in SL, on the order of 6.5 in in total length), making it comparable to its complex-mates rather than one of the giant pikes. The colour pattern is the species' most diagnostic feature and the source of its name. Against a pale grey to brownish ground colour it carries a single, continuous black lateral band running the length of the flank — and, crucially, it lacks the vertical bars and scattered dark spots that mark close relatives such as Crenicichla mandelburgeri and Crenicichla ypo. The describers also separated it on a relatively high lateral-scale count (about 53–64 in the E1 row) and on details of fin pigmentation. Sexual dimorphism follows a clear pattern: females typically carry a broad black longitudinal stripe in the dorsal fin, whereas males instead show rows of dark spots in the fin, and males grow somewhat larger and longer-snouted in the usual Crenicichla manner. The whole gestalt — slim body, pointed head, unbroken dark stripe — is convergent with the only other pelagic pike cichlid, the unrelated Crenicichla celidochilus of the Uruguay River, an example of the same body plan evolving twice for the same open-water hunting life.
Habitat
Crenicichla yjhui is endemic to a single small watershed: the Arroyo Urugua-í, a left-bank tributary of the middle Paraná River in Misiones Province, northeastern Argentina. Its known range is essentially the Urugua-í drainage and, very prominently, the large reservoir (Embalse Urugua-í) impounded on that stream — the type locality and the open water in which the species' pelagic habits are most easily seen. This makes yjhui unusual among pike cichlids in two ways at once: it occupies open, mid-water habitat rather than the rocky bottom most of its relatives cling to, and a substantial part of its habitat is a man-made standing-water body rather than flowing stream. The Urugua-í lies in the subtropical Atlantic-forest belt of Misiones, in waters that are soft to moderately mineralised and roughly circumneutral; no detailed in-situ chemistry was published with the description, but waters of this part of the Paraná system generally run around pH 6.5–7.5 and across a real seasonal temperature swing, roughly 64–82 °F through the year. The species is sympatric — and partly syntopic — with two other closely related endemic pikes of the same complex, Crenicichla ypo (a specialised snail-crusher) and the smaller Crenicichla yaha, the three partitioning the same short stretch of water by feeding very differently. As an open-water fish, yjhui ranges through the upper part of the water column rather than confining itself to the substrate; documented occurrence is in the shallow-to-mid depths of the reservoir and stream rather than deep water.
Feeding
Feeding is what sets Crenicichla yjhui apart. Where the great majority of pike cichlids are bottom-oriented ambush predators that lunge at prey from cover, yjhui is a pelagic predator that hunts in open water and feeds predominantly on fishes — a piscivore that pursues its prey through the middle of the water column. Together with the unrelated Crenicichla celidochilus of the Uruguay River it is one of only two pelagic species known in the entire large riverine genus, and the two arrived at this niche independently, a striking case of parallel evolution. Its slim, streamlined body, pointed snout and large mouth are the morphological signature of that open-water, fish-eating ecology. The mandelburgeri complex as a whole is a showcase of repeated trophic specialisation: from a generalist invertebrate-eating ancestor the group has produced, over and over, the same set of 'ecomorphs' — generalist invertivores, robust-jawed molluscivores that crush snails, crevice-pickers, algae-scraping periphyton grazers, and, in yjhui, the open-water piscivore. Because the complex's species are largely sympatric, this division of feeding roles is precisely how so many close relatives manage to coexist in one small drainage: yjhui takes the fishes of the open water while Crenicichla ypo crushes molluscs and Crenicichla yaha works the invertebrate fauna.
Mating
No detailed account of courtship or pair formation has been published for Crenicichla yjhui specifically, so its reproductive behaviour is inferred from the well-documented pattern across the genus. Pike cichlids are not shoaling fish; outside breeding they are solitary and territorial. Reproduction reorganises them into pairs — a male and a female form a bond and jointly establish and defend a breeding territory centred on a cave, crevice or other sheltered nest site. As in other Crenicichla, the female is the more conspicuously marked sex around spawning; in yjhui the sexes already differ in the dorsal fin (a solid stripe in females, rows of spots in males), and ripening females of the genus typically flush with contrasting colour that they present to the larger male during courtship. Pair formation in pike cichlids can be fraught, because males are substantially larger and an unready or mismatched female may be harassed; this, together with the species' rarity outside its native drainage, is why first-hand mating accounts for yjhui are essentially absent. Its open-water habits make it plausible that nest sites are sought along the structured margins of the reservoir and stream rather than in the open mid-water where the fish feeds.
Breeding
Breeding has not been documented for Crenicichla yjhui in the wild or in aquaria, and no fecundity figures have been published for it; the account here is drawn from its close relatives and from the genus as a whole, and should be read as genus-typical rather than species-confirmed. Crenicichla are biparental cave or crevice spawners. The female lays a clutch of adhesive eggs on the roof or wall of a sheltered cavity — among rocks, under a ledge, or inside a hollow — and tends, cleans and fans them while the male patrols and defends the surrounding territory. Clutch size in pike cichlids of this body size is on the order of a few hundred eggs (congeners typically lay roughly 100–500 adhesive eggs). The eggs hatch within a few days; the parents then move the wrigglers to pits, and once the fry are free-swimming both adults guard them as a tight school, leading them out to forage and herding them back to shelter at any disturbance. Parental care is extended and shared until the young disperse. In the subtropical Paraná system, spawning is most plausibly tied to the warm, high-water season.
In the aquarium
Crenicichla yjhui is essentially never seen in the ornamental trade. It is a narrow-range, scientifically collected fish known from a single Argentine reservoir and its feeder stream, not a commercial export, and there is no established body of hobbyist experience with it specifically. Anyone wishing to keep it would have to extrapolate from the husbandry of other medium-sized, subtropical Crenicichla of the lacustris group — which is well understood — and the following is offered on that basis, not as a tested protocol for this species. A pike of around 5 in SL (with the slim build adding length) needs a long tank: a single fish or a bonded pair is best housed in something on the order of 47 in / 4 ft or more (roughly 250+ litres), aquascaped with rockwork, driftwood and caves that create defended sightlines and retreats over a sand or fine-gravel bottom. Being a subtropical, partly open-water fish from the Paraná system, it wants cooler, well-oxygenated water than tropical Amazonian cichlids — a yearly range around 64–79 °F with a genuine cool season, soft to moderately hard water, and pH near neutral (about 6.5–7.5). Its pelagic, fish-hunting nature means open swimming space matters more than it would for a bottom-dwelling pike, and strong, clean, oxygenating flow suits it well. Diet is straightforward for a piscivore: meaty foods — earthworms, prawn, mussel, and live or frozen fish-substitutes — weaning onto good sinking and slow-sinking pellets, with no reliance on feeder fish. The cautions are the usual pike-cichlid ones, sharpened by this species' active predation: it is a committed fish-eater and will take any tankmate small enough to swallow, and it is intolerant of conspecifics outside a settled pair, so a roomy tank, careful pairing and the option to separate fish are essential. This is a specialist's fish, and its rarity means virtually all aquarists will only ever encounter related pikes rather than yjhui itself.
Conservation
Crenicichla yjhui has not been assessed by the IUCN Red List — a direct search of the Red List returns no record for the species, consistent with its description only in 2019, after most Neotropical fish assessments were completed — so its formal status is Not Evaluated (NE). That absence of a status should not be read as security: yjhui is one of the most narrowly distributed cichlids imaginable, endemic to a single small drainage and its reservoir in Misiones, the kind of pinpoint range that ordinarily flags a species as vulnerable. Its habitat sits within the heavily transformed Atlantic-forest streamscape of Misiones, where deforestation, agricultural expansion and the damming of the Paraná and its tributaries for hydropower have reshaped the river network; the very reservoir that is the species' type locality is itself an impoundment, and the species' fortunes are now tied to the management of an artificial water body. Because the whole mandelburgeri complex consists of many such single-tributary endemics, the group is regarded as a conservation priority among Neotropical fishes, and yjhui's lack of a Red List category reflects a gap in assessment rather than an established absence of risk. It carries no CITES listing.
